Google has added a security feature (Factory Reset Protection) to its Android OS. This feature is important and is intended to avoid misuse of the device during thefts. But at the same time, some users have got into trouble because of it, when they have forgotten their GMAIL or password credentials after the hard reset. How to disable FRP (factory reset protection):

in your Samsung Galaxy J4 Plus device, The FRP feature will automatically Enable you as soon as you add a Google Account to your Samsung Galaxy J4 Plus. If you want to disable it, you just need to delete your account.
